Pseudosepsis in rheumatoid arthritis due to cellular and lipid abnormalities in synovial fluid
M J Garton1, P M Gordon, J A Rennie
1Department of Rheumatology, City Hospital, Aberdeen.
Abstract:
In acute septic arthritis, the synovial fluid is usually frankly purulent. However, the presence of pus does not always imply the presence of infection, and some synovial fluids are easily mistaken for pus. An exaggeration of the normal leucocyte response in inflammatory joint fluids may alone simulate sepsis; marked increases in certain lipid fractions of the fluid may produce similar appearances. We describe a patient who presented with two examples of such 'pseudoseptic arthritis'.
